What to Know About Beans Pricing

The price of beans in South Africa is influenced by local agricultural yields, import rates, and inflationary pressures. Seasonal demand and supply chain logistics also play a significant role in determining retail prices. These factors explain how much beans cost in South Africa and why there can be price variations throughout the year.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why do bean prices vary between stores?

Prices can differ based on store promotions, supplier agreements, and the type of beans offered.

Are canned beans more expensive than dried beans?

Yes, canned beans typically cost more due to processing, but they are convenient and ready to eat.

Can buying in bulk reduce the cost of beans?

Absolutely, larger packages often have a lower price per kg compared to smaller packs.
